1. Recently, there was this debate on CH regarding the influence of caste on marriages and what we can do to eradicate this menace from our society.
2. Castes in Kashmir have three basic types of origins

1. The ancestral place you belonged to
2. The profession of your ancestors
3. A nickname given to one of your ancestors
3. One of the main reasons why the caste system survives in any society is because its proponents derive its legitimacy from religion and whenever something has supposedly religious origins, we cannot question the practice.

1. In Kashmiri, we have this term Gaenz Nass.

For those who don’t know the origins, GaenzKhod is a certain place in Srinagar which is famous for animal-hides.
2. So, naturally, that place stinks like anything. If you pass by that place, you can barely stand the smell then what about people living there?
There is this famous story that, one household there got a new daughter-in-law who complained about the smell.
3. During her initial days, she used to roam around covering her face which was a sight of embarrassment when her kith and kin visited her.
So, she took the matter into her own hands and regularly cleaned the place.
